How Does Malathion Work? The Nitty-Gritty

Now, how does this thing actually knock out those pesky ants? It all comes down to their nervous system. Malathion works by disrupting the way insects’ nerves communicate with each other. Think of it like throwing a wrench into a well-oiled machine. This disruption causes a buildup of a chemical called acetylcholine, which then leads to paralysis and, ultimately, the demise of the insect. So, in layman’s terms, it messes with their signals until they can’t function anymore. Sounds pretty intense, right?

Malathion: Different Flavors for Different Pests

Just like your favorite ice cream, Malathion comes in different formulations. You’ll typically find it in a few forms:

  • Liquid Concentrates: These are the heavy-duty versions you dilute with water and use in sprayers. They’re great for covering larger areas, like your garden or the perimeter of your house.
  • Dusts: These are fine powders that you can puff into cracks, crevices, and other hard-to-reach spots. They’re perfect for targeting ants hiding in walls or under appliances.
  • Aerosol Sprays: Sometimes sold in aerosol cans for easier spot treatments.

Each formulation has its own best use-case scenario, so it’s good to understand what you’re dealing with before you start spraying. Different pests, different methods!

Spray It, Dust It, But Don’t Eat It (and Neither Should the Ants)

So, you’ve identified your ant nemesis and decided Malathion’s the weapon of choice. Now what? How do you unleash this stuff effectively? Here’s the lowdown:

  • Spraying: A perimeter spray around your home’s foundation can create a barrier that keeps ants from crossing over. You can also target direct nest treatments. Just picture yourself as the ant terminator, zeroing in on their headquarters.
  • Dusting: Ever notice ants sneaking through tiny cracks and crevices? That’s where dusting comes in handy. A light dusting of Malathion in these areas can hit those ants where they live.
  • Baiting: This is where things get interesting. Malathion isn’t typically used in ant bait formulations. Why? Because ants are smart. They prefer tasty treats, and Malathion’s not exactly the sweetest deal. Other insecticides are generally considered better for baiting as ants can carry the “treat” back to the colony to kill the Queen.

Weather or Not: External Factors

The effectiveness of Malathion isn’t just about the ants themselves. The environment plays a huge role, so you’ll need to keep these conditions in mind:

  • Weather: Rain is Malathion’s arch-nemesis. A good downpour can wash away your efforts faster than you can say “ants, be gone!”.
  • Soil Type: The type of soil around your home can affect how well Malathion works. Some soils absorb the insecticide more readily, reducing its effectiveness.
  • Colony Size: Taking on a few stray ants is one thing, but tackling a supercolony is a whole different ballgame. Larger colonies require a more comprehensive approach. If a colony is too big, you might consider getting assistance from a professional.

First Aid 101: What to Do If Exposed

Accidents happen, right? So, let’s cover some quick and easy first aid measures:

  • Skin contact: Wash the affected area thoroughly with soap and water.
  • Eye contact: Rinse your eyes with plenty of water for at least 15 minutes.
  • Inhalation: Get to fresh air immediately.
  • Ingestion: Contact a poison control center or seek medical attention right away.

Ant Resistance and Alternative Treatments: Exploring Other Options

Okay, so you’ve been battling ants with Malathion, but what happens when those little buggers start laughing in the face of your efforts? That’s right, we need to talk about insecticide resistance. It’s like the ants are hitting the gym and getting superpowers, but instead of lifting weights, they’re evolving to shrug off your chemical warfare! Over time, ant populations exposed to Malathion can develop a resistance, rendering it less effective. It’s basically natural selection in action, with the strongest (or rather, most resistant) ants surviving and passing on their genes. This can leave you scratching your head, wondering why your go-to ant killer suddenly isn’t cutting it anymore.

Managing and Preventing Resistance: Outsmarting the Ants

So, how do we stay ahead of the evolutionary curve? One key strategy is rotating insecticides. Think of it like mixing up your workout routine—don’t let the ants get too comfortable with any one type of chemical attack. Another powerful approach is integrated pest management (IPM). IPM is all about using a combination of methods to control pests, from sealing up cracks and removing food sources to using different types of treatments. This way, you’re not relying solely on Malathion (or any single insecticide), which reduces the pressure for resistance to develop. It’s like a multi-pronged assault that keeps the ants guessing.

Other Insecticides: Bringing Out the Big Guns (Responsibly)

If you need something with a bit more oomph, consider these alternatives:

  • Borates: Especially boric acid baits. These are slow-acting but effective, as the ants carry the bait back to the colony, poisoning the whole lot.
  • Pyrethrins and Pyrethroids: These are nerve toxins derived from chrysanthemum flowers and are generally considered safe for pets.
  • Insect Growth Regulators (IGRs): These disrupt the ants’ development, preventing them from reproducing. It’s like birth control for ants!

Does malathion effectively control ant infestations?

Malathion, an organophosphate insecticide, affects the insect nervous system significantly. This chemical interferes with acetylcholinesterase, a crucial enzyme essential for nerve function. Ants, like other insects, rely on this enzyme for transmitting nerve signals. When malathion inhibits acetylcholinesterase, it causes a buildup of acetylcholine. This buildup leads to continuous nerve stimulation, resulting in paralysis and eventual death of the ant. Malathion exhibits broad-spectrum insecticidal properties making it effective against various ant species. The effectiveness of malathion depends on factors such as concentration, application method, and ant species’ resistance.

What is the impact of malathion on ant colonies?

Ant colonies function as superorganisms exhibiting complex social structures. Malathion targets individual ants disrupting colony dynamics. Worker ants, responsible for foraging, come into contact with malathion-treated surfaces introducing the insecticide into the colony. The poison spreads through trophallaxis, a process where ants share food and liquids distributing malathion among colony members. Malathion affects the queen ant, the reproductive center, reducing egg production and colony growth. A significant reduction in worker ant population impairs the colony’s ability to forage and defend itself. The overall impact leads to colony weakening or collapse, depending on the extent of malathion exposure.

How does malathion compare to other ant control methods?

Malathion represents one of several options available for ant control. Compared to baits, malathion acts as a contact poison providing quicker results. Baits rely on ants carrying the poison back to the colony, resulting in a delayed effect. In contrast to barrier treatments, malathion directly targets ants on treated surfaces reducing the chance of colony relocation. Boric acid, another common insecticide, works by disrupting the ant’s digestive system requiring ingestion. Malathion offers a different mode of action affecting the nervous system directly. Natural remedies like diatomaceous earth provide a non-toxic alternative working by dehydrating the ants. The choice between malathion and other methods depends on factors like infestation size, environmental concerns, and desired speed of control.

What are the environmental considerations for using malathion against ants?

Malathion is a broad-spectrum insecticide affecting non-target insects and organisms. Its application can harm beneficial insects like bees and butterflies disrupting local ecosystems. Malathion persists in the environment undergoing degradation through sunlight and microbial action. The breakdown products can still pose risks to aquatic life and other sensitive species. Soil contamination can occur with excessive or improper use affecting plant growth and soil health. Regulatory agencies monitor malathion use setting guidelines to minimize environmental impact. Integrated pest management strategies emphasize responsible use reducing reliance on chemical controls.
